Travis DeGaton Wins with POWRi SWEM at Mohave Valley Raceway Return

Travis DeGaton Wins with POWRi SWEM at Mohave Valley Raceway Return

Belleville, IL. (10/4/25) Competing in the series' second time at the outstanding hosting venue of Mohave Valley Raceway, the rapidly growing POWRi Avanti Windows & Doors Southwest Ecotec Midget Series would contend in a single night of weekend battles in the sixteenth seasonal event as Travis DeGaton would earn the hard-fought feature victory over the racing weekend.

Kickstarting the weekend night of series excitement with eager entries at Mohave Valley Raceway with the POWRi SWEM Series would witness Dayton Shelton, Grant Schaadt, and Tyler Merrill each notching the heat racing wins, as Tyler Merrill would earn the high point qualifier award for the event.

Going green flag racing in the feature would find fifteenth-starting Travis DeGaton wheel his way to victory by passing fourteen other drivers and leading the final four of the twenty laps to win his third series victory. Pole-starting Tyler Merrill would lead early to finish runner-up ahead of AJ Hernandez, placing third from starting fourth as Adam Teves advanced a position to finish fourth, with seventh-starting Troy DeGaton rounding out the top-five finishers at Mohave Valley Raceway.
